Setting Your Moral Compass: Applied Ethics in OSINT

Invitation Only

The rapid growth in capability and credibility of open source experts working on nuclear policy has allowed this community to take more prominent roles informing the public policy debate. Still nascent is how well the community manages its ethical practices. The community is increasingly aware of this lag but still in the early stages of discussing and coordinating on such challenges.

Participants will take part in a training module and case studies exercise on the ethics of open source analysis. This exercise, designed and facilitated by Melissa Hanham, will have participants work through several case studies of real ethical challenges faced by nonproliferation analysts working with OSINT.
